Analyzing the Market: Average Freelance Web Designer Salary

Freelancing in web design can be a lucrative venture. The average salary for freelance web designers fluctuates greatly depending on variables such as experience, location, and popularity for their web design freelance rates abilities.

According to recent reports, the average freelance web designer can make anywhere from $30,000 to $70,000 per year. However, seasoned designers with a strong portfolio and comprehensive knowledge of the latest technologies can attain salaries well surpassing this range.

It's important to note that these figures are simply averages. A freelance web designer's actual earnings will depend on a number of individual factors.

Developing Your Portfolio: Essential Skills for Freelance Web Designers

Launching a successful freelance web design career hinges on showcasing your talent and expertise. A robust portfolio acts as your visual resume, demonstrating your skills and attracting potential clients. To build a portfolio that truly shines, you'll need to hone several essential skills.

  • Visualize captivating website designs that align with client needs and brand identities.
  • Bring to Life your designs using industry-standard tools and technologies, including HTML, CSS, and JavaScript.
  • Communicate effectively with clients to understand their vision and deliver solutions that exceed expectations.
  • Enhance websites for performance, user experience, and search engine visibility.

By cultivating these skills, you'll be well on your way to creating a portfolio that highlights your value as a freelance web designer. Remember, your portfolio is a dynamic reflection of your talents and should be continually evolved to showcase your latest work and growth.
